In 2015, the applicant pool for this institution was comprised of:
| Applicant Pool | Applications | Acceptances |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Men | 8,386 | 6522 | 77% |
| Women | 11,028 | 8,555 | 77% |
| Total | 19,414 | 15,077 | 77% |

In 2015, the enrollment at this institution was comprised of:
| Degree Type | Part Time | Full Time |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 4,372 | 22,915 | 27,287 |
| Graduate | 2,324 | 3,177 | 5,501 |
| Undergraduate | 2,048 | 19,738 | 21,786 |

Below is the average financial aid information for those who were entering postsecondary education for the first time in 2015.
| Grant | Num Students | Pct Students | Avg Amount |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Federal Grant | 648 | 14% | $4,586 | $2,971,412 |
| State/Local Grant | 38 | 1% | $2,311 | $87,803 |
| Institution Grant | 2,583 | 57% | $8,357 | $21,585,839 |
| Loan Aid | 1,509 | 33% | $8,027 | $12,112,022 |
| Total Aid | 2,954 | 65% | $8,343 | $24,645,054 |
